5.6.1 Radio Transmitters (Part 15)
This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is subject to
the following two conditions: (1) this device may not cause harmful
interference, and (2) this device must accept any interference received,
including interference that may cause undesired operation.

IC statement
This device complies with Industry Canada license-exempt RSS standard(s).
Operation is subject to the following two conditions: (1) this device may not
cause interference, and (2) this device must accept any interference, including
interference that may cause undesired operation of the device.

In accordance with the regulations of Industry Canada, this radio transmitter
can operate with an antenna of a type and a maximum gain (or lower)
approved for the transmitter by Industry Canada. With the aim of reducing the
risk of radio interference to other users, the chosen antenna type and its gain
should be selected so that the equivalent isotropically radiated power (e.i.r.p.)
does not exceed the intensity necessary for the establishment of a satisfactory
connection.
